Book Description
Published in 1928, this "biography," follows Orlando, a young nobleman in the prime of his life, as he begins his life in the court of Elizabeth I. Through unknown means, Orlando does not age past his prime, but instead goes through radical transformations, ending the book in the twentieth century as a woman. Orlando's story focuses on love, purpose, the difficulty in understanding one's place in the world. Woolf's most unique work, Orlando remains an influential work in gender and sexuality studies.
